Definition and Purpose of a Motion to Dismiss in Referenced Bankruptcy: A Motion to Dismiss in Referenced Bankruptcy is a legal document filed by a party involved in bankruptcy proceedings seeking to terminate the case. This motion requests the court to dismiss the bankruptcy petition due to specific reasons deemed valid under Iowa bankruptcy laws. It serves to halt the bankruptcy proceedings and allow the court to assess the legitimacy of the case's continuation. 2. Common Reasons for Filing a Motion to Dismiss: a. Lack of Proper Documentation: A motion to dismiss may be filed if the petitioner fails to provide all necessary documentation or required supporting evidence. b. Failure to Conduct Credit Counseling: If the petitioner has not completed a mandatory credit counseling course within the specified timeframe before filing for bankruptcy, a motion to dismiss may be appropriate. c. Fraudulent Filings: If there is evidence suggesting that the petitioner filed for bankruptcy fraudulently or tried to deceive the court, a motion to dismiss can be filed to challenge the petitioner's actions. d. Improper Venue or Jurisdiction: If the bankruptcy case is filed in the wrong district or jurisdiction, a motion to dismiss can be submitted to challenge the court's jurisdiction over the case. 3. Format and Content of an Iowa Sample Letter for Motion to Dismiss in Referenced Bankruptcy: When drafting an Iowa Sample Letter for Motion to Dismiss in Referenced Bankruptcy, it is crucial to follow a proper format and include specific content: a. Heading: Include the name of the court, the parties involved, the case number, and the date. b. Introduction: State clearly that the purpose of the letter is to file a motion to dismiss in the referenced bankruptcy case. c. Background: Provide a brief overview of the case, highlighting the reason for filing the motion to dismiss. d. Legal Basis: Explain the legal grounds supporting the motion, referencing specific statutes or case laws relevant to the situation. e. Supporting Evidence: Include any necessary documentation or evidence to strengthen the motion. f. Conclusion: Request the court to dismiss the bankruptcy case based on the reasons detailed in the motion. g. Signature: Sign and print the name of the filer, including their contact information. In Iowa, you have to file an action against the other party to seek enforcement of the existing court decree order. The enforcement action is formally known as an Application for Rule to Show Cause, commonly referred to as a contempt filing. This filing brings the opposing party's bad acts to the court's attention.

What are the steps in a Contempt of Court action? We file an application for a contempt citation, including the facts supporting the application, with the Clerk of Court, and serve it on the person ordered to pay support. The court holds a hearing to decide whether the violation of the support order is willful.
